The MLA3-2i is a 3-way, axisymmetric large format line array system designed specifially for permanent installatin. The system is engineered to deliver high defiitin, high SPL sound reinforcement for a broad range of applicatins, including concert halls, stadiums, and large clubs.
Each MLA3-2i line array cabinet features two manifold loaded 12” McCauley 8231 Low-Mid drivers, two 77087 8” Midrange Drivers and two 1.0” exit compression drivers on a 90° x 10° slot-loaded wave guide.
The McCauley 8231 Low-Mid driver is built around a new fild serviceable motor with integrated aluminum heat sink. The new motor design has a thinner, 0.3” top plate and longer 0.9” by 4.0” diameter aluminum coil which improves the linearity of the Bl vs. displacement profie. The 8231 Low-Mid driver features a hybrid composite-paper cone which balances light weight and high stifess, to improve overall sensitiity, with the internal damping that is inherent to paper cone loudspeakers.
The coupling of the cone drivers and high frequency waveguide has been specially engineered to produce a rich and fully balanced sound from 50 Hz to 18 kHz. The 8231 12” low-mid drivers are manifold loaded to improve the sensitiity over their operatig band and increase array density. The 77087 8” midrange drivers are phase plug loaded to match the pattrn of the HF around the crossover frequency and reduce cabinet to cabinet interferences. The HF slot loaded waveguide is optiized to reduce resonances which would require DSP equalizatin. The sensitiity of each component has been specifially engineered for the MLA3-2i to allow for the extra HF headroom which is oftn required in longer throw applicatins.
